Abstract

The invention provides a rechargeable card password recognition method and system and a storage medium. The method comprises the steps: collecting a password region image of a rechargeable card through a terminal, carrying out the recognition processing of the password region image of the card through a first rechargeable card recognition model operated in the terminal, and extracting a rechargeable card password; the server generates a training sample based on the password region image and the rechargeable card password, and uses the training sample to train a second rechargeable card recognition model; and the server updates the first rechargeable card recognition model based on the trained second rechargeable card recognition model. According to the method, the system and the storage medium disclosed by the invention, the password of the rechargeable card is extracted by using the rechargeable card recognition model, the recognition efficiency is high, the recognition result accuracy is high, the network time consumption is saved, the recognition efficiency can be improved, the applicability is higher, and high-quality service experience is provided for a user.
